Introduction

In today’s connected digital world, every device and server has a unique IP address. However, sometimes you don’t just want to know the IP — you need to identify the hostname linked to that IP. Hostnames help make sense of numeric IP addresses by assigning human-readable names like server.example.com.

Why Use an IP to Hostname Tool?

Using an IP to Hostname Tool offers several benefits:

  • Network Troubleshooting – Quickly identify which server or device is causing an issue.
  • Improved SEO & Analytics – Understand visitor origins by resolving IPs to hostnames.
  • Cybersecurity Checks – Detect suspicious IPs and uncover their real identities.
  • Server Management – Ensure your DNS records are set up correctly.
  • Reverse Lookup Needs – Easily perform reverse DNS lookups for emails and domains.

By resolving IP addresses into hostnames, you gain better insights into network behavior, website visitors, and server configurations.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: What is the difference between an IP and a hostname?
An IP is a numeric identifier, while a hostname is a human-readable name associated with that IP.

Q2: Can I find a hostname for private IPs (like 192.168.x.x)?
No, private IP addresses don’t resolve to public hostnames.
